The Celsius Scale
The Celsius scale, also known as the centigrade scale, was developed by Anders Celsius in 1742. It is widely used around the world, especially in scientific contexts. Key points include:- The freezing point of water: 0°C
- The boiling point of water: 100°C
- The scale is based on the properties of water, making it intuitive for everyday life and scientific research.
The Celsius scale is part of the metric system and has a straightforward relationship with the Kelvin scale used in thermodynamics.
How to Convert Fahrenheit to Celsius
Mathematical Formula
Converting Fahrenheit to Celsius involves a simple mathematical formula:\[ C = \frac{(F - 32) \times 5}{9} \]
Where:
- \( C \) is the temperature in Celsius
- \( F \) is the temperature in Fahrenheit
This formula subtracts 32 from the Fahrenheit temperature, then multiplies the result by 5, and finally divides by 9 to get the Celsius equivalent.

Approximate and Exact Conversion
While 65.56°C is the precise conversion, sometimes an approximate value suffices, especially in everyday contexts. Rounding to the nearest whole number:- 150°F ≈ 66°C
This approximation is useful for quick estimations or when precise measurements are not critical.

Related Temperature Conversions and Comparisons
Common Temperatures in Fahrenheit and Celsius
Understanding how 150°F compares to other temperatures can provide context:- Freezing point of water: 32°F (0°C)
- Boiling point of water: 212°F (100°C)
- Human body temperature: approximately 98.6°F (37°C)
- Fever threshold: 100.4°F (38°C)
- Hot summer day: around 86°F (30°C)
- Extreme heat: 150°F (~66°C)
As seen, 150°F is significantly higher than typical human body temperature, indicating extreme heat conditions suitable for specific industrial or culinary applications.
Other Conversion Examples
- 0°F = -17.78°C
- 32°F = 0°C
- 100°F = 37.78°C
- 212°F = 100°C
These examples help in understanding the progression and relationship between the two scales.
